Benefits of Personalized Coaching

One of the biggest benefits of personalized coaching is the ability to receive one-on-one attention. This allows you to work at your own pace and focus on the areas in which you need the most help. A coach can help you identify your strengths and weaknesses and provide you with strategies for improvement. This type of personalized attention is especially valuable for individuals who need help with group or online training.

Another benefit of personalized coaching is working with a coach with experience and expertise in your field. This means that you can benefit from their knowledge and experience, and they can help you develop the skills you need to be successful. A coach can also provide industry insights and help you navigate the job market.

Personalized coaching also allows you to set goals that are specific to your needs. Whether you want to improve your communication skills, increase your productivity, or develop your leadership skills, a coach can help you identify your goals and provide the tools you need to achieve them. This level of individualized attention can be particularly beneficial for individuals seeking a promotion or career change.

Benefits of Feedback

Feedback is a critical component of personal and professional growth. It helps us identify our strengths and areas that need improvement. When we receive feedback, we can use it to adjust our behaviour and improve our skills. Feedback can also help us develop self-awareness and better understand how others perceive us.

One of the biggest benefits of feedback is that it gives us an objective view of our performance. We may think we are doing well, but feedback can help us identify blind spots and areas where we need improvement. This constructive criticism can be particularly helpful in the workplace, where we are often too close to the situation to see it objectively.

Feedback also helps us build relationships. When we receive feedback from our colleagues or supervisor, we can better understand their perspectives and develop a deeper level of trust. This can help us work more effectively as a team and improve our performance.

How Personalized Coaching and Feedback Work Together

Personalized coaching and feedback are two sides of the same coin. A coach can provide individualized attention and help you develop the skills you need to succeed. Feedback can help you identify areas where you need improvement and provide you with the guidance you need to adjust your behaviour.

When you work with a coach, they can provide you with regular feedback on your performance. This can include observations of your behaviour and suggestions for improvement. The input can be used to adjust your coaching plan and ensure that you are making progress towards your goals.

Coaching can also help you prepare for feedback from others. A coach can help you identify areas where you need improvement and provide strategies for addressing them. This can help you feel more confident when you receive feedback and allow you to use it constructively to improve your performance.
